World Cup: Olly Murs joins EastEnders star Shaun Williamson celebrating England’s win over Iran

Olly Murs proudly wears his Three Lions jersey as he joins fans and EastEnders star Shaun Williamson celebrating England’s 6-2 win over Iran at the World Cup

Olly Murs was in the mood to celebrate on Monday as he watched the Three Lions win the opening World Cup game against Iran, 6-2.

The singer, 38, erupted into cheers as England won the match, as he watched the game alongside crowds at BOXPARK Wembley.

Also in attendance and cheering England on was EastEnders star Shaun Williamson, 57, who got up on stage at the event.

Former X Factor star Olly shared a video of himself cheering as England scored a goal, captioning it: ‘What a time to press record.’ 

England supporters in pubs, fan parks and homes across the country went wild after the Three Lions raced into a 3-0 first half lead in their opening World Cup game against Iran.

Millions of fans have packed out pubs and fan parks across the country after booking the day off work or calling in sick – as the nation is grinding to a halt to watch the Gareth Southgate’s men in action this afternoon.

England demolished Iran 6-2 in their opening match of the Qatar World Cup – their strongest ever start to a major tournament on a record-breaking afternoon for the Three Lions.
